What Exactly Is Dense Breast Tissue—and Why Does It Matter for Your Health?
Breast density refers to the proportion of fibrous and glandular tissue compared to fatty tissue within your breasts. On a mammogram, both dense tissue and potential cancerous growths appear white. This creates a “masking effect,” where suspicious areas can be hidden by the dense tissue, making them difficult to detect. This phenomenon is a primary reason why women with dense breasts often seek additional screening methods.
Research consistently indicates that women with dense breasts face a higher relative risk of developing breast cancer. For instance, individuals with extremely dense breasts may experience approximately a twofold increased risk compared to those with scattered density, according to comprehensive meta-analyses and large cohort studies. It’s vital to remember, however, that this is a modest elevation. Having dense breasts alone does not guarantee breast cancer development, as numerous other factors—such as family history, age, and lifestyle choices—also play significant roles.
A crucial statistic highlights the prevalence: roughly 40-50% of women over 40 are classified as having dense breasts (categorized as heterogeneously dense or extremely dense on the BI-RADS scale used by radiologists). This means millions of women receive this notification following their routine mammograms, underscoring the widespread relevance of understanding this topic.
How Breast Density Can Impact Your Mammogram Experience
Standard 2D mammograms remain a cornerstone of breast cancer screening, unequivocally proven to reduce mortality rates. However, for women with dense breasts, the effectiveness of these mammograms can be reduced. This diminished sensitivity means that some cancers might not be as readily visible or detectable.
Recent legislative updates, including federal mandates for breast density reporting in mammogram results, ensure that you are informed about your breast density. This transparency empowers women to ask the critical question: “Is a mammogram enough for me, or do I need more?”
Increasing evidence supports the consideration of supplemental screening for specific women with dense breasts, especially when other risk factors are present. Two notable recent studies offer valuable insights:

- One significant randomized trial, often cited in discussions about advanced imaging, compared options such as abbreviated breast MRI, contrast-enhanced mammography, and automated breast ultrasound in women with dense breasts who had a negative mammogram. This study revealed that contrast-enhanced techniques were more effective at detecting early-stage cancers than ultrasound alone.
- Another study underscored the benefits of combining molecular breast imaging with 3D mammography (tomosynthesis), demonstrating that this dual approach nearly doubled cancer detection rates in dense tissue compared to either method used in isolation.
These findings collectively suggest that for some women, incorporating an additional layer of screening could significantly improve early cancer detection. However, it’s important to recognize that a “one-size-fits-all” approach does not apply; personalized assessment is key.
Understanding Your Personal Risk Profile: Dense Breasts Plus Other Factors
Breast density is an important piece, but only one component of your overall breast cancer risk assessment. Here’s a quick overview of how density categories relate to screening considerations:
- Low density (mostly fatty): Minimal masking effect; mammograms are highly effective.
- Scattered density: Quite common; presents a modest impact on detection.
- Heterogeneously dense: More tissue overlap; often warrants a discussion about supplemental screening options.
- Extremely dense: Highest masking effect and relative risk increase; typically where advanced supplemental options are most strongly considered.
Beyond breast density, several other elements significantly influence your risk:
- Family history or genetic factors: A strong family history of breast cancer or known genetic mutations (e.g., BRCA1/2).
- Age: Risk generally increases with age.
- Reproductive history: Age at first period, timing of menopause, and history of pregnancies.
- Lifestyle choices: Factors such as maintaining a healthy weight, limiting alcohol consumption, and physical activity.
To gain a clearer understanding of your individual lifetime risk, tools like the Breast Cancer Risk Assessment Tool (from the National Cancer Institute) or the Tyrer-Cuzick model can be incredibly helpful. Make sure to ask your doctor to review these assessments with you.
